Debate on bill on Friday, 25 April 2008, in the House of Lords, led by Earl of Caithness. The answering member was Lord Davies of Oldham.


Safety Deposit Current Accounts Bill [HL]

Safety Deposit Current Accounts Bill (HL). Lords second reading debate. Agreed to on question and committed to a Committee of the Whole House.
